MEMO — Sales Leads

Procurement has begun evaluating a second-source supplier for the Kestrel valve line after Norvik Components flagged capacity limits. Marla Denning is leading vendor screening in Haltby, with samples expected within six weeks. Please hold customer commitments on extended volumes until qualification completes. The strategic context is summarized below.

internal memo for kafop-haduf: Headcount on the Ralix team goes from 9 to 140 by the end of April. Gross margin on Ralix came in at 5 percent against a plan of 5 percent.

☐ GC pauses — Brindlematch service. Verify that the matching loop's stop-the-world pauses stay under 20 ms at peak load, per the tuning baseline from the Halvern incident review. Confirm the pause histogram is exported and alerting thresholds match the runbook. Reviewers should reject changes that allocate inside the hot path. Sign-off on this item must come from the engineer named below.

named custodian: Brivan Eliath Quenox Frador

Hi Tomas,

Handover for tonight: the lockers in the south changing room got reshuffled today, so half the crew will be confused. Night shift is now rows C and D only — rows A/B belong to the Drayfield cleaning team. Spare padlocks are in the supervisor drawer if anyone's lost theirs. The changing-room door got a new keypad fitted this afternoon, and the new code is below.

door code, kawip-bagap: bdg-HQEWH-4

The Varnholt Metals contract expires end of Q3. Renewal terms are under negotiation; expect a 4% price increase on coil stock and revised delivery windows for the Dresmark and Ostley branches. Do not commit to customer lead times beyond October until terms are signed. Procurement will circulate the final schedule once countersigned. Branch managers should audit current Varnholt stock levels by Friday and flag shortfalls to regional ops. The note below summarizes the confidential negotiating position.

board note of tawig-bajof: The renewal with Ralixix Holdings closes at $10 million a year, 20 percent above the last contract. Project Druix slips by two quarters because of the tooling delay.